How to prepare for a job interview at McDonald's United Kingdom
✨Know the Menu Inside Out
Before your interview, take some time to familiarise yourself with the restaurant's menu. Being able to discuss specific items and express enthusiasm for the food will show that you're genuinely interested in the role and the brand.
✨Show Off Your Communication Skills
Since strong communication is key for this position, practice articulating your thoughts clearly. You might want to prepare answers to common questions about teamwork and customer service, highlighting any relevant experiences you have.
✨Demonstrate Your Team Spirit
This role requires collaboration, so be ready to share examples of how you've worked well in a team before. Think of situations where you helped others or contributed to a positive atmosphere, as this will resonate well with the interviewers.
✨Dress for Success
Even though it's a fast-food environment, first impressions matter! Dress smartly and neatly for your interview. It shows respect for the opportunity and indicates that you take the role seriously.
